is a patrician villa in Vivaro di , , northern , designed in 1554 and traditionally attributed to the Italian Renaissance architect Andrea Palladio, but not included by UNESCO in the strict list of Palladian Villas of Veneto within the World Heritage Site City of Vicenza and the Palladian Villas of the Veneto. is situated 1 km north of Campo da calcio di Vivaro.

is a Romanesque-style, Roman Catholic church located on Strada Marosticana in the neighborhood of Polegge of , region of , Italy. The church was once part of a Lombard abbey. is situated 1 km east of Campo da calcio di Vivaro.
